### Step 4: Pin the Quillkit version

Before upgrading services to Quillkit 3.x, pin each consumer to the last 2.x tag and run the compatibility checker. The checker records results in the shared migrations database; if it cannot reach it, confirm the tunnel is up and connect using the string below.

primary connection of yagep-kahip = redis://giliel_svc:zYiKsLL2PLpfPL@db-348f.xolmarsys.corp:5432/fenwyn

# Artifact Signing — Payment Retry Idempotency Builds

Quick notes for the release manager: every build of the Tollbranch retry worker ships with its idempotency-key generator baked in, so the artifact has to be signed or the payment gateway refuses to register it. Retries reuse the same idempotency key per attempt chain, which is why an unsigned or tampered build is dangerous — duplicate charges, angry tickets, the works. Sign the artifact before tagging the release. The current release signing key is below.

rollout seal: bky9_PeXH1fTLY

**Q: Why do exported reports from Quillbeam show UTC instead of my local time?**

Short answer: we normalize everything to UTC at export so audit trails stay consistent across regions. The viewer re-localizes on render, but raw CSVs stay UTC on purpose. If you need to verify a timestamp against the signing vault, you'll want the vault's recovery passphrase handy. It's kept below.

recovery phrase for fajep-yaweg: gilath-sorox-wenius-rusdor-keliel-zorius

## Account Recovery — Inkmill Render Pipeline

Scope: loss of the pipeline service account used by the Inkmill markdown renderer.

1. Halt scheduled renders from the Foxglove scheduler.
2. Confirm no in-flight builds remain in the queue.
3. Open the sealed recovery console on the bastion host.
4. Re-issue the service credential; old tokens revoke automatically.

Release manager sign-off required before step 3. The recovery console will not accept the reissue command until you enter the passphrase shown below.

unlock words, yadup-yagef: zorael-druix